How to Use Flash Drive as RAM



If your computer is slow and you can’t use your computer properly, then you can use a removable disc as RAM. USB drive can be used as cache to speed up your computer. You can do this by following some simple steps.

1.      Go to my computer


2.      Right click on the drive and go to ‘Properties’


3.      Click the ‘Ready Boost’ tab on the top


4.      Go to ‘Use this Device’ and move the slider to adjust the amount of RAM required.


5.      Now click Apply and Ok.


6.      Your Removable Drive will now function as RAM.


Tips:

·         It doesn’t work in Windows XP. It works only in Windows 7 and Windows Vista.

·         It works better in Windows 7.
